Thanks guys, I have a distinct rumble from the drivetrain originatiing from under the center of the car when I accelerate from start, it is accentuated if I'm turning right, any ideas?

The description sounds like a center support bearing on the driveshaft is beginning to come apart. An inspection of the driveshaft is called for. It may also be a u-joint on the driveshaft that has become bound or is frozen up. This might require replacement of the driveshaft.
